Output 07efaefb13fc96e9ae2695697eaade5307d110ebd2cd9cf34de959eadff8d009:1

value
999541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fc0d2e7da1edce27b2a2e12b5d87880f1a4b749 OP_EQUAL
address
3ARK7QN6Brq8CWWaXp6XU7ijxmLeyQqkN2
transaction
07efaefb13fc96e9ae2695697eaade5307d110ebd2cd9cf34de959eadff8d009
confirmations
416703
spent
true